tcp可以提供什么服务
在网络通信的世界中,TC(传输控制协议)作为一种重要的通信协议,扮演着举足轻重的角色。它为我们提供了哪些服务?**将为您深入剖析TC能提供的种种便利。
一、保证数据传输的可靠性 TC协议通过确认应答和重传机制,确保数据在传输过程中的完整性和可靠性。在数据传输过程中,发送方将数据分割成多个数据包,发送到接收方。接收方收到数据包后,会发送确认应答给发送方。如果发送方在一定时间内未收到确认应答,则会重新发送该数据包,直至收到确认应答为止。
二、流量控制与拥塞控制 TC协议通过流量控制机制,防止发送方发送的数据超过接收方的处理能力。TC协议还具备拥塞控制功能,根据网络拥塞程度动态调整发送方的发送速率,确保网络稳定运行。
三、提供有序的数据传输 TC协议保证数据传输的顺序性,确保接收方按照发送方发送数据的顺序接收数据。这对于需要按顺序处理数据的场景至关重要,如文件传输、网页浏览等。
四、实现端到端的数据传输 TC协议提供端到端的数据传输服务,使得发送方和接收方可以在不同的网络环境中进行通信。这大大提高了网络的互操作性,使得各种设备可以轻松接入互联网。
五、适应不同的网络环境 TC协议能够适应不同的网络环境,如带宽、延迟、丢包率等。这使得TC协议在各种网络场景下都能发挥出良好的性能。
六、支持多种应用层协议 TC协议是许多应用层协议的基础,如HTT、FT、SMT等。这些应用层协议在TC协议的基础上,实现了各自的功能,如网页浏览、文件传输、邮件发送等。
七、提供错误检测与恢复机制 TC协议在数据传输过程中,会对数据进行错误检测。一旦检测到错误,会启动错误恢复机制,确保数据传输的可靠性。
八、实现数据的可靠传输 TC协议通过序列号、确认应答和重传机制,确保数据的可靠传输。这使得TC协议在数据传输方面具有较高的可靠性。
九、支持多种数据传输模式 TC协议支持多种数据传输模式,如流模式、数据报模式和会话模式。这些模式可以根据不同的应用场景选择合适的传输方式。
十、易于实现和维护 TC协议的设计简洁、易于实现,同时具备良好的可维护性。这使得TC协议被广泛应用于各种网络设备中。
十一、提供端到端的安全保障 TC协议可以通过加密、认证等手段,为端到端的数据传输提供安全保障。这使得TC协议在安全方面具有较高的可靠性。
TC协议为我们的网络通信提供了诸多便利,如保证数据传输的可靠性、实现端到端的数据传输、适应不同的网络环境等。在日常生活中,我们享受着TC协议带来的便捷,不禁感叹网络世界的神奇。
- 上一篇:430显卡玩什么
- 下一篇:miui9有什么变化